is a village in Vilkaviškis district municipality, Lithuania. According to the 2011 census, it had 44 residents. It is best known as the birthplace of Jonas Basanavičius, one of the most prominent activists of the Lithuanian National Revival. is situated 3½ km southeast of Sausininkų Ežeras.
